[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: форма отравки
Страницы: 1, 2
CompMaster16
Доброго вечера всем ! прошу помощи . сразу скажу я в пхп не шарю помогите как исправить форму отправки на емайл номера телефона !
то есть есть форма "Обратный звонок" но поле для ввода сделано для поля емейла. А когда хочется туда вписать номер телефона за место емайла то не дает защита . какой файл править и что именно подскажите
inpost
Как поменять поле? Это достаточно ПРОСТО зная хотя бы основы HTML.
Если не знаешь, то, я думаю, стоит за МАЛЕНЬКУЮ очень денюшку договориться с программистом и тебе сделают wink.gif

_____________
Обучаю веб-программированию качественно и не дорого: http://school-php.com
Фрилансер, принимаю заказы: PHP, JS, AS (видео-чаты). Писать в ЛС (Личные сообщения на phpforum).
arbuzmaster
Если не хочется за денежку то можно так например 8-904@341-54-54.ru user posted image

_____________
Мой первый сайтик

Посмотри на свой XBMC под другим углом
CompMaster16
сколько ?
И еще ньанс сайт сделан на Адоб музе надо провеку убрать и поставить проверку что б телефон только вписывали и что б уже было вписано +7
CompMaster16
Цитата (arbuzmaster @ 14.05.2015 - 23:01)
Если не хочется за денежку то можно так например 8-904@341-54-54.ru user posted image

user posted image тоже вариант но не каждый догодается помогите
arbuzmaster
Кликаем правой кнопкой мышки и выбираем |просмотр кода страницы| далее |Ctrl+F| найти
 input type="email" 
меняем в исходнике email на text и сохраняем. Потом берем ноги в руки и идем например сюда быстренько изучаем (а пока все работает без проверки)

_____________
Мой первый сайтик

Посмотри на свой XBMC под другим углом
CompMaster16
не нашел
 input type="email" 

в каком файле искать
CompMaster16
Search "email" (38 hits in 5 files)
C:\Users\Rinatey\Desktop\сайт\site\scripts\form-u145.php (15 hits)
Line 17: emailFormSubmission();
Line 21: function emailFormSubmission()
Line 33: $message .= '<tr><td valign="top" style="background-color: #ffffff;"><b>Электронная почта:</b></td><td>' . htmlentities($_REQUEST["Email"],ENT_COMPAT,'UTF-8') . '</td></tr>';
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 42: $headers = 'From: zakaz@master-zainsk.ru' . PHP_EOL . 'Reply-To: ' . $formEmail . PHP_EOL .'X-Mailer: Adobe Muse 2014.0.30 with PHP/' . phpversion() .'/'. PHP_OS . PHP_EOL . 'Content-type: text/html; charset=utf-8' . PHP_EOL;
Line 53: echo '{"MusePHPFormResponse": { "success": false,"error": "Failed to send email"}}';
Line 57: function cleanupEmail($email)
Line 57: function cleanupEmail($email)
Line 59: $email = htmlentities($email,ENT_COMPAT,'UTF-8');
Line 59: $email = htmlentities($email,ENT_COMPAT,'UTF-8');
Line 60: $email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);
Line 60: $email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);
Line 61: return $email;
C:\Users\Rinatey\Desktop\сайт\site\scripts\form-u186.php (15 hits)
Line 17: emailFormSubmission();
Line 21: function emailFormSubmission()
Line 33: $message .= '<tr><td valign="top" style="background-color: #ffffff;"><b>Электронная почта:</b></td><td>' . htmlentities($_REQUEST["Email"],ENT_COMPAT,'UTF-8') . '</td></tr>';
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 41: $formEmail = cleanupEmail($_REQUEST['Email']);
Line 42: $headers = 'From: zakaz@master-zainsk.ru' . PHP_EOL . 'Reply-To: ' . $formEmail . PHP_EOL .'X-Mailer: Adobe Muse 2014.0.30 with PHP/' . phpversion() .'/'. PHP_OS . PHP_EOL . 'Content-type: text/html; charset=utf-8' . PHP_EOL;
Line 53: echo '{"MusePHPFormResponse": { "success": false,"error": "Failed to send email"}}';


это я уже искал во всех открытых документах - email
feramon_87
Вф можете ссылку дать на страницу если оно в инете__!? Это у вас как я знаю файл приема формы!

или попробуй комментировать эти строчки ...

Line 60: $email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);
Line 60: $email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);

Вот так__

Line 60: //$email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);
Line 60: //$email = preg_replace('=((<CR>|<LF>|0x0A/%0A|0x0D/%0D|\\n|\\r)\S).*=i', null, $email);
CompMaster16
http://master-zainsk.ru/
feramon_87
Найди в шаблоне эти строчки

<input class="wrapped-input" type="text" spellcheck="false" id="widgetu150_input" name="Email" tabindex="5">

измени id и class __ Вот и все!
feramon_87
Должно быть в папке http://master-zainsk.ru/scripts/
CompMaster16
на какой класс ?
нашел в индекс .хтмл
feramon_87
Можете отправить скрипт на электронку ___?? Завтра сделаю вам... щас поздно!
feramon_87
На любой! Попробуй отправить __ а примет ли запросы ваша форма не могу сказать! Вы щас получили на почту мой номер__?? вроде отправился __

И еще сперва измени только вот это, data-type="email" на data-type="text"

Должно получиться__ HTML походу
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.